This started as my 2013 Street Glide motor. Am I missing anything from a parts perspective? R&R is going to return the motor to me with the heads mounted, so I’ll just have to put the motor back into the bike and bolt the rest into place. They are going to set compression 10.5:1. They recommended the woods valve springs, roller rockers, lifters, and compression for this build.
Should I replace the compensator with a baker? Should I replace clutch spring or plates? Now would be the time to do it since I’ve got everything apart.
